Job Title: Maintenance Mechanic

Location: Greater Toronto Area, Ontario

Salary Range: Up to $28.85 per hour.

Status: Full Time

About the Role:
We are seeking a motivated and responsible Mechanic to join our team specializing in floor cleaning equipment. The ideal candidate is someone who has a positive attitude, a strong work ethic, and a willingness to learn new skills. This role involves inspecting, troubleshooting, repairing, and maintaining a variety of commercial and industrial janitorial cleaning machines to ensure they operate efficiently and safely at the warehouse or at client sites.

What You Will Do:

  • Work closely with the Warehouse and Procurement Teams
  • Maintain accurate service and repair records.
  • Responsible for troubleshooting, repairs, and maintenance of various mechanical & electrical issues on janitorial cleaning equipment such as Walk Behind/Ride On Auto Scrubbers, Propane/Electric Burnishers, Industrial Sweepers, Wet/Dry Vacuums, Carpet Extractors, Swing Machines, Golf Carts, etc.
  • Keep work area organized, safe, and clean.
  • Collaborate with supervisors and team members to ensure timely equipment turnaround.
  • Ability to lift 50+ lbs on an regular basis.
  • Regular travel between company sites and client locations is required; a valid Ontario Class G driver’s license and access to reliable transportation are required.
  • Read and interpret parts manuals to identify correct part numbers.
  • Accurately report repair activities, parts used, and causes of failure in the online application.
  • Maintain spare parts inventory and prepare detailed reports on usage and stock levels.
  • Use Microsoft Office applications (Excel, Word, Outlook) for documentation and reporting.

What You Bring:

  • At least 2 years experience with repairing/troubleshooting a wide variety of cleaning equipment.
  • Ability to adapt to new tasks, machines, and technologies.
  • A willingness to learn and keen attention to detail.
  • Positive, team-oriented attitude with a strong sense of responsibility.
  • Ability to lift 50+ lbs on an regular basis.
  • Regular travel between company sites and client locations is required; a valid Ontario Class G driver’s license and access to reliable transportation are required.
  • A recent driving record is required.
  • The ability to communicate necessary fixes and apply training to repair equipment.
